What does a solar panel cleaner do?

A solar panel cleaner is responsible for maintaining the efficiency of solar panels by removing dirt, dust, bird droppings, and other debris from their surfaces. Regular cleaning ensures that the panels receive maximum sunlight, which helps them generate more electricity. This job often involves using specialized equipment and cleaning solutions to avoid damaging the panels. Solar panel cleaners may work for solar installation companies, cleaning services, or as independent contractors. Their work helps extend the lifespan of solar panels and improve overall system performance.

What are some common challenges faced by solar panel cleaners in the field?

Solar panel cleaners often work outdoors and must navigate various weather conditions, such as extreme heat or rain, which can affect both safety and efficiency. Accessing rooftop panels can sometimes require additional safety equipment and careful planning to prevent accidents. Additionally, cleaners must be mindful to use the correct cleaning methods and products to avoid damaging sensitive panel surfaces while ensuring optimal energy output. Coordination with facility managers or homeowners is also essential to schedule cleanings at appropriate times without disrupting regular activities.

What is the difference between Solar Panel Cleaner vs Solar Panel Technician?

AspectSolar Panel CleanerSolar Panel Technician
CredentialsNone typically required, safety training preferredCertifications often required, such as NABCEP
Work EnvironmentOutdoor, on rooftops or ground-mounted systemsOutdoor, may include installation, maintenance, troubleshooting
Job ResponsibilitiesCleaning solar panels to optimize efficiencyInstalling, repairing, maintaining solar systems

While both roles work outdoors on solar systems, Solar Panel Cleaners focus solely on cleaning to improve efficiency, whereas Solar Panel Technicians handle installation, repairs, and maintenance. The Technician role typically requires certifications and broader technical skills, while Cleaners usually need safety training. Both jobs are essential in the solar industry but serve different functions.

The AutoMist Technician plays a vital role in the success of Kept Companies by performing scheduled monthly, quarterly, and hood and exhaust system cleaning services for restaurants and commercial kitchens. This position ensures that all work meets fire protection and safety guidelines, including NFPA 96 standards, while delivering exceptional service and maintaining company equipment to the highest standards.


The ideal candidate is professional, safety-focused, mechanically inclined, and capable of working independently in the field. All duties must be performed efficiently, accurately, and in alignment with company standards.


Key Responsibilities

  • Perform scheduled commercial kitchen hood and exhaust system cleaning services monthly and quarterly inspections on the AutoMist system
  • Ensure compliance with fire protection and safety requirements, including NFPA 96 requirement
  • Inspect exhaust systems and document any NFPA 96 deficiencies for management and customer review
  • Troubleshoot technical and operational issues and implement effective solutions in the field
  • Safely install new systems and de-install (remove) equipment at customer locations
  • Complete work orders, inspection forms, and digital documentation using company mobile applications
  • Maintain company tools, equipment, and vehicle in clean, safe, and fully functional condition
  • Follow all company safety procedures and standard of operations
  • Provide professional, courteous communication to restaurant staff and facility personnel and provide training
  • Participate in monthly travel assignments, including occasional single overnight stays


Requirements

  • High school diploma or equivalent required
  • Valid driver's license with a clean driving record
  • Experience in commercial hood cleaning, fire protection services, mechanical work, or related fields preferred
  • Working knowledge of NFPA 96 standards (training provided as needed)
  • Comfortable using mobile applications and digital reporting tools as well as hand tools, power tools, and basic mechanical knowledge
  • Ability to work flexible hours, including evenings, overnight shifts, and select weekends
  • Ability to lift 50+ pounds, climb ladders, and work in confined or elevated spaces
  • Strong attention to detail and commitment to safety
